"We can say that the trump cards of 'Superman II' became the downfall of 'Superman III'. Unfortunately, director Richard Lester decided to go further into using humour, bringing in actor Richard Pryor ('The Express of Chicago') to be the antagonist. With a confusing script, the movie drags on for more than 2 hours. Perhaps the best part here is the fight of the Man of Steel against a kind of "evil twin", which doesn't make much sense, but made for some good memes in more recent times. Recommended only to the most hardcore fans of the character."
